On Tue, Jun 26, 2007 at 04:06:38PM +0800, linlei 60022748 wrote: > diff -urN -X linux-2.6.21.1-vanilla/Documentation/dontdiff linux-2.6.21.1-vanilla/drivers/usb/storage/initializers.h linux-2.6.21.1/drivers/usb/storage/initializers.h > --- linux-2.6.21.1-vanilla/drivers/usb/storage/initializers.h 2007-04-28 05:49:26.000000000 +0800 > +++ linux-2.6.21.1/drivers/usb/storage/initializers.h 2007-06-25 23:01:18.000000000 +0800 > @@ -47,3 +47,6 @@ > /* This function is required to activate all four slots on the UCR-61S2B > * flash reader */ > int usb_stor_ucr61s2b_init(struct us_data *us); > + > +/* This places the HUAWEI E220 devices in multi-port mode */ > +int usb_stor_switch_ports_init(struct us_data *us); Generally, these functions are named to refer to the devices they are used for (i.e. the ucr61s2b in the previous function). > diff -urN -X linux-2.6.21.1-vanilla/Documentation/dontdiff linux-2.6.21.1-vanilla/drivers/usb/storage/unusual_devs.h linux-2.6.21.1/drivers/usb/storage/unusual_devs.h > --- linux-2.6.21.1-vanilla/drivers/usb/storage/unusual_devs.h 2007-04-28 05:49:26.000000000 +0800 > +++ linux-2.6.21.1/drivers/usb/storage/unusual_devs.h 2007-06-25 23:01:18.000000000 +0800 > @@ -1371,14 +1371,15 @@ > US_SC_DEVICE, US_PR_DEVICE, NULL, > US_FL_IGNORE_RESIDUE ), > > -/* This prevents the kernel from detecting the virtual cd-drive with the > - * Windows drivers. <[email protected]> > +/* This tells the usb driver to place the HUAWEI E220 devices into multi-port mode > + * Reported by fangxiaozhi <[email protected]> > + * and by linlei <[email protected]> > */ > -UNUSUAL_DEV( 0x12d1, 0x1003, 0x0000, 0xffff, > +UNUSUAL_DEV( 0x12d1, 0x1003, 0x0000, 0x0000, Do you really want a device range from 0 to 0?
